19:00Windsor· GB · 2026-05-23
Bodhi Solutions - Constructing Champions Handicap
· Good To Firm· Flat· Turf
Result
| Pos | Draw | Horse | Jockey / Trainer | SP | Best | Btn | OR | RPR | TS | Comment |
|---|---|---|---|---|---|---|---|---|---|---|
| 1 | 6 | Bintola (GB) 3yo | Lewis Edmunds | 20/1 21.000 | — | won | 74 | 79 | — | Midfield - towards rear 3f out - headway when switched right 2f out - headway from over 1f out - led inside final furlong - kept on(op 14/1) |
| 2 | 2 | Marengo Storm (GB) 3yo | Finley Marsh | 9/4F 3.250 | — | 1.25L | 80 | 81 | — | Midfield - headway when not clear run over 1f out - not clear run then ran on inside final furlong - went second final strides(op 5/2) |
| 3 | 5 | Grey Horizon (GB) 3yo | Christian Howarth | 33/1 34.000 | — | 0.30L | 69 | 69 | — | Led - headed and weakened inside final furlong(op 25/1) |
| 4 | 1 | Akabusi (GB) 3yo | Tom Queally | 20/1 21.000 | — | 1.00L | 77 | 74 | — | Prominent - hung right from over 1f out - weakened final 110yds(op 16/1) |
| 5 | 4 | Comic Strip (IRE) 3yo | Liam Wright | 12/1 13.000 | — | 0.10L | 80 | 76 | — | In touch with leaders - prominent over 1f out - weakened inside final furlong(op 14/1) |
| 6 | 8 | Powder Monkey (IRE) 3yo | Jack Callan | 15/2 8.500 | — | 2.75L | 70 | 58 | — | Midfield - pushed along from over 3f out - no impression from over 1f out(op 9/1 tchd 7/1) |
| 7 | 12 | Up The Agenda (IRE) 3yo | Jonny Peate | 14/1 15.000 | — | 0.10L | 76 | 63 | — | In rear - some headway over 1f out - stayed on inside final furlong(op 12/1) |
| 8 | 13 | Generous Rascal (GB) 3yo | Mason Paetel | 11/2 6.500 | — | 0.75L | 76 | 61 | — | Slowly away - in rear - headway from over 2f out - weakened inside final furlong(op 9/2 tchd 4/1 and tchd 5/1) |
| 9 | 10 | Ecclefechan (GB) 3yo | Donagh Murphy | 12/1 13.000 | — | 0.20L | 73 | 57 | — | Towards rear - midfield over 1f out - weakened inside final furlong(op 9/1) |
| 10 | 15 | Firewalker (GB) 3yo | Rowan Scott | 7/1 8.000 | — | 1.75L | 75 | 54 | — | Towards rear throughout(op 9/1) |
| 11 | 9 | Kesta (IRE) 3yo | Kaiya Fraser | 6/1 7.000 | — | 0.05L | 80 | 59 | — | Midfield - weakened inside final furlong(op 17/2) |
| 12 | 3 | Fresh Fade (IRE) 3yo | Kieren Fox | 40/1 41.000 | — | 2.25L | 80 | 51 | — | In touch with leaders - weakened from over 2f out(op 33/1) |
| 13 | 11 | Romantic Twilight (GB) 3yo | Paddy Bradley | 22/1 23.000 | — | 1.00L | 77 | 45 | — | Taken down early - slowly away - in rear throughout(op 25/1) |
| 14 | 7 | Alkuwarrior (IRE) 3yo | Gina Mangan | 50/1 51.000 | — | 0.50L | 71 | 38 | — | Pressed leader early - in touch with leaders after 1f - weakened from 2f out(op 40/1) |
| — | 14 | Sargent Dennis 3yo G · 129lb | Rose Dawes(5) | — | — | — | 74 | 93 | 92 | — |
| — | 16 | Hayynah 3yo F · 135lb | Dougie Costello | — | — | — | 80 | 83 | 80 | — |
Winning time: 1m 10.37s (slow by 0.57s)
Pre-race AI predictions · what we said before the race ran
| Jockey / Trainer | Form | ELO_T | ELO_J | # | Stars | Tier | BF | Slip | |||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
2 dr.2 | 3yo | — trip … | — | — | — | 2 | ⭐⭐⭐⭐⭐ | PRIMARY Winner | — | — | |||||||||
9 dr.13 | 3yo | — trip … | — | — | — | 3 | ⭐⭐⭐⭐ | PRIMARY Winner | — | — | |||||||||
1 dr.9 | 3yo | — trip … | — | — | — | 4 | ⭐⭐⭐⭐ | PRIMARY Winner | — | — | |||||||||
5 dr.3 | 3yo | — trip … | — | — | — | 5 | ⭐⭐⭐⭐ | PRIMARY Maiden | — | — | |||||||||
7 dr.1 | 3yo · tb | — trip … | — | — | — | 6 | ⭐⭐⭐⭐ | PRIMARY Winner | — | — | |||||||||
15 dr.8 | 3yo | — trip … | — | — | — | 7 | ⭐⭐⭐⭐ | PRIMARY Lightly raced | — | — | |||||||||
3 dr.4 | 3yo | — trip … | — | — | — | 8 | ⭐⭐⭐⭐ | PRIMARY Winner | — | — | |||||||||
8 dr.12 | 3yo | — trip … | — | — | — | 9 | ⭐⭐⭐⭐ | PRIMARY Returner | — | — | |||||||||
16 dr.5 | 3yo · v | — trip … | — | — | — | 11 | ⭐⭐⭐⭐ | SECONDARY Maiden | — | — | |||||||||
10 dr.15 | 3yo | — trip … | — | — | — | 12 | ⭐⭐⭐ | SECONDARY Lightly raced | — | — | |||||||||
13 dr.10 | 3yo | — trip … | — | — | — | 13 | ⭐⭐⭐ | SECONDARY Maiden | — | — | |||||||||
14 dr.7 | 3yo | — trip … | — | — | — | 14 | ⭐⭐⭐ | SECONDARY Maiden | — | — | |||||||||
6 dr.11 | 3yo | — trip … | — | — | — | 15 | ⭐⭐ | OUTSIDER Returner | — | — | |||||||||
12 dr.6 | 3yo | — trip … | — | — | — | 16 | ⭐⭐ | OUTSIDER Returner | — | — | |||||||||
NR dr.14 | NR 3yo G · 129lb | 5221 12d trip … | 129 | 1 | ⭐⭐⭐⭐⭐ | PRIMARY Winner | — | — | |||||||||||
NR dr.16 | NR 3yo F · 135lb · p | 62-217 42d trip … | 135 | 10 | ⭐⭐⭐⭐ | SECONDARY Winner | — | — |
Click any runner row for the original spotlight, framework breakdown and pedigree. Use this to compare what the model predicted vs how the race actually played out.
Loading AI analysis…
Rating from HRV Framework v4.1: 10 deterministic dimension scores combined into a field-relative rating where the top horse in each race scores 100. Tiers PRIMARY / SECONDARY / OUTSIDER / NO CHANCE band off that rating. See methodology. 18+. BeGambleAware.